Dripping Dish washer


This is most likely one of the most daily dish washer problem, as well as the good news is that it is very easy to determine. Leakages happen due to several reasons, as well as the leakages can make a mess of your cooking area. Usual sources of dishwasher leakages consist of;

 

  • Incorrect pipe link: If the pipes at the back of your maker are not securely fixed or if they are worn, it can trigger leakages.

  • Incorrect meal stacking: Constantly make certain that you do not overstack the tray and that you arrange the dishes properly

  • Excessive detergent: Putting sufficient cleaning agent might also cause a leakage. Ensure that you place just sufficient for your recipes and not more.

  • Corrosion: It can also be a result of some corrosion or deterioration of your maker. In this instance, it is better to change the dishwasher.

  • Door Seals: Examine if the door seals are still undamaged as well as safely secured. If the seals are not ready, maybe a significant source of leaks.

  • Does unclean appropriately

  • If your meals and also cutleries appear of the dish washer and also still look unclean or unclean, your spray arms might be a trouble. In a lot of cases, the spray arms can get obstructed, as well as it will need a fast clean or a substitute to work successfully once more.

    Inability to Drain pipes


    Often you may observe a big amount of water left in your tub after a wash. That is possibly a water drainage issue. You can either examine the drain hose for damages or blockages. When in doubt, call an expert to have it checked as well as dealt with.

  • Bad-Smelling Dishwashing machine

  • This is an additional typical dishwasher issue, and it is generally brought on by food particles or oil remaining in the equipment. In this situation, look for these particles, take them out as well as do the meals without any recipes inside the machine. Laundry the filter extensively. That will assist get rid of the poor odor. Make sure that you get rid of every food fragment from your recipes prior to transferring it to the device in the future.

    7 Common Dishwasher Problems (and How to Fix Them)

     

    Dirty, smelly, possibly covered in cheese. Is there anything more frustrating than opening the dishwasher only to find the dirty dishes are still there?! I mean, the main reason you buy a dishwasher is so you don’t have to deal with dirty dishes. C’mon dishwasher, you had one job.


    A little maintenance goes a long way when it comes to appliances, but the truth is nothing lasts forever (sadly). That doesn’t mean it’s hopeless, though. With a handful of simple tricks, you can fix some of the most common dishwasher problems and bring that sparkle back into your dishwasher and back into your life.

     

    My Dishes Are Still Dirty

     

    This is at the top of a list for a reason. Dirty dishes are common and frustrating. Easy fixes first; check if your dishwasher has a manual filter and make sure that it’s clean and clear of debris. Then, as you load your dishwasher, make sure that the spray arms can rotate freely, spraying water throughout the drum. If they’re blocked or obstructed, you won’t be getting optimal cleaning performance. If the problem continues, check if your spray arms are clean and moving freely as grease and food particles can prevent them from spinning.


    Also, stop pre-rinsing your dishes! Modern dishwashers use sensors to determine the soil level of the dishes. If you rinse them off too much, your dishwasher may select a shorter cycle than is necessary. Modern detergents also use enzymes that activate when they come in contact with food particles. If you remove the particles, your detergent will be less effective too.

     

    My Dishes Aren’t Drying

     

    The easiest fixes here are to add Rinse Aid to your dishwasher when you start the load to assist drying, and to make sure you don’t stack plastic against plastic or other hard to dry materials. It’s also a good idea to open the dishwasher door when the cycle is complete to release steam and prevent condensation from settling on your dishes (some higher-end machines even open automatically). If your dishwasher has a heating element, you may have to check if it is working properly. Check also the fan if your dishwasher has a stainless steel tub that uses blown radiant heat to dry.

     

    My Dishwasher Smells Bad

     

    If your dishwasher smells bad, make sure your filter and screens are cleaned of any grime and food residue. Check the spray arms and gasket on the door to make sure there’s no grease or food waste there as well. If you’ve done that, then it may just be time to sanitize the drum. Place a small bowl with vinegar in the upper basket of your empty dishwasher and run the sanitize cycle (or the hottest cycle you’ve got) to blast away bad odours.

     

    My Dishwasher Won’t Start

     

    If your dishwasher won’t start there’s often an electrical problem, and if you’re lucky that means there’s a very easy fix. Ask yourself, have I tried turning it off and on? If not, then do that. If it’s still not working, try unplugging and re-plugging in the machine and double-check your breaker to make sure power is feeding the unit. If it’s a mechanical problem, then it may be that your door isn’t latching properly and a simple realignment will get things sorted out.

     

    My Dishwasher Won’t Fill

     

    If possible, check your intake valves and make sure that the screen is clear and that there’s no blockage obstructing water flow. If that’s not it, then the float and/or float switch located at the bottom of the drum could be the problem. Make sure that the electrical connections are intact and that the mechanism hasn’t been damaged or blocked in any way.
